Output d50dd18326934dfd80dd413bca94f1f3c46df9a8e90d9fd69322dff853f0e62b:0

value
95426032
script pubkey
OP_0 OP_PUSHBYTES_20 81c20ac3057b81b14eb87d63311e770fc17f873e
address
bc1qs8pq4sc90wqmzn4c043nz8nhplqhlpe7nj0r2h
transaction
d50dd18326934dfd80dd413bca94f1f3c46df9a8e90d9fd69322dff853f0e62b
spent
true